iGaming Security - Quick Tips

Most online gaming platforms are heavily focused on providing a secure environment for their players. With the rise of cyber threats and hacking incidents, ensuring the safety of your personal and financial information while gaming online should be a top priority. Here are some quick tips to enhance your iGaming security:

1. Use Strong Passwords: Make sure to create complex passwords that include a mix of letters, numbers, and special characters. Avoid using easy-to-guess passwords like “123456” or “password”. Regularly update your passwords and never share them with anyone.

2. Enable Two-Factor Authentication: Adding an extra layer of security like two-factor authentication can significantly reduce the risk of unauthorized access to your gaming account. This typically involves receiving a code on your phone that you must enter after logging in with your password.

3. Keep Your Software Updated: Ensure that your operating system, antivirus software, and gaming platform are up to date with the latest security patches. Developers frequently release updates to fix vulnerabilities and protect against new threats.

4. Be Cautious with Links and Downloads: Avoid clicking on suspicious links or downloading files from untrustworthy sources. Malicious links and downloads can contain malware that compromises your device’s security and puts your information at risk.

5. Use Secure Payment Methods: When making deposits or withdrawals on iGaming platforms, use reputable and secure payment methods. Avoid sharing your banking details on unsecured websites and always double-check the site’s encryption protocols.

6. Limit Personal Information Sharing: Be cautious about sharing personal information on gaming platforms. Only provide necessary details for your account creation and avoid disclosing sensitive data that could be used for identity theft.

7. Educate Yourself on Phishing Scams: Stay informed about common phishing tactics used by cybercriminals to trick users into revealing their login credentials or financial information. Be wary of emails or messages asking for sensitive data or urgent actions.

8. Monitor Your Account Activity: Regularly check your gaming account activity for any suspicious logins or transactions. Report any unusual behavior to the platform’s support team immediately and change your password if you suspect unauthorized access.

By following these quick tips, you can significantly enhance your iGaming security and enjoy a safer online gaming experience. Remember that staying informed and proactive about security measures is crucial in protecting your personal information and financial assets while gaming online.
